MBC President Kim Jae-chul to Step Down

The President of Korean broadcaster MBC has offered to resign.
Kim Jae-chul, who took over in March last year, submitted his letter of resignation to MBC's largest shareholder, the Foundation for Broadcast Culture.
Although the broadcaster said that Kim's decision came to pressure the Korea Communications Commission, which refused to approve a merger of two regional stations, some speculate that Kim stepped down to run in next year's general elections.
